As a Department Manager you're at the forefront of creating excellent customer experiences that go beyond the expected. With a passionate and dedicated team by your side, you will lead with energy and purpose-setting the tone for a store environment that's not only welcoming and inspiring but also drives results. Your leadership ensures every customer journey feels personal, genuine, and memorable, while your focus on service and operational excellence helps bring the brand to life on the shop floor.

Key Responsibilities

  • Deliver a high level of customer service through expert styling advice, strong product knowledge, and an engaging store experience.
  • Analyse sales data and collaborate with the Store Manager to maximise department performance.
  • Lead and motivate a team of Sales Advisors to consistently achieve service and presentation standards.
  • Support recruitment efforts and ensure effective onboarding and training for new team members.
  • Identify and nurture future talent, contributing to development plans that support team progression.
  • Oversee daily store operations, ensuring efficiency and alignment with brand standards.
  • Act as a brand ambassador, consistently delivering the best possible experience for every customer.
  • Step into the role of Store Manager when required, ensuring continuity in leadership and performance.

This is a full-time position with a 12-months temporary contract of 39 hours a week. Please apply by sending in your CV in English as soon as possible.

Benefits

We offer all our employees attractive benefits with extensive development opportunities around the globe. All our employees receive a 25% staff discount, usable on all our products.

How to prepare for a job interview at & OTHERSTORIES

✨Know Your Customer Service Stuff

As a Department Manager, you'll need to showcase your expertise in customer service. Brush up on the latest trends in customer experience and be ready to share examples of how you've gone above and beyond for customers in the past.

✨Show Off Your Leadership Skills

Prepare to discuss your leadership style and how you motivate a team. Think of specific instances where you've led a team to success or helped someone grow in their role. This will demonstrate your ability to inspire and develop talent.

✨Get Familiar with Sales Data

Since analysing sales data is part of the job, make sure you understand how to interpret it. Be ready to talk about how you've used data to drive performance in previous roles and what strategies you implemented to improve results.

✨Be Ready to Step Up

The role may require you to act as a Store Manager, so be prepared to discuss your approach to store operations. Highlight any experience you have in managing daily operations and ensuring everything runs smoothly while maintaining brand standards.
